2012-08-24 3 views
5

이 튜토리얼은 http://software.danielwatrous.com/wordpress-plugin-licensing-wicket-on-google-app-engine/입니다. 이 프로젝트에 Google 앱 엔진 라이브러리를 추가 한 다음 Google 앱 엔진을 확인하고 싶습니다. 하지만이 일식에는이 문제가 있습니다.Google 애플리케이션 엔진에서 maven 프로젝트를 실행하는 방법

The App Engine SDK '/home/hudi/program/git/tournamenSystem/tournament-system/ 
tournament-system-web/src/main/webapp/WEB-INF/lib/appengine-api-1.0-sdk-1.7.1.jar' 
on the project's build path is not valid (SDK location '/home/hudi/program/git/ 
tournamenSystem/tournament-system/tournament-system-web/src/main/webapp/WEB-INF/ 
lib/appengine-api-1.0-sdk-1.7.1.jar' is not a directory) 

나는 이해하지 못합니다. 항아리 디렉토리가 왜 그렇게 어떤 디렉토리를 원합니까? 빠른 수정을 사용하려면 다른 SDK를 사용할 수 있습니다. 나는 1.6 버전을 사용하려고 노력하지만 ... 여전히 같은 문제. 어떻게 해결할 수 있습니까? 제발 도와주세요

답변

5

가능한 해결책은 이클립스에서 appengine 엔진 설정을 통해 appengine을 추가하고 appengine 설정에 의해 추가 된 sdk가 언급 된 것 (예 :/home/hudi/program/git/tournamenSystem/tournament-system) 앞에 나타나는지 확인해야합니다. /tournament-system-web/src/main/webapp/WEB-INF/lib/appengine-api-1.0-sdk-1.7.1.jar)을 빌드 경로에 추가하십시오. 이 방법으로 애플리케이션은 appengine SDK를 Google 플러그인에서 참조하며 오류를주는 경로는 참조하지 않습니다.

나는 maven dependency에서 포함 된 sdk jar 파일에 대해 오류가 발생하는 곳과 동일한 문제가있었습니다. 도움이 될 것입니다. 실제로

Goole App Engine Setting

Build path order

+0

나는 바닥에 모든 시스템 라이브러리 의존성을 이동하는 동일한 나를 위해 오류 해결 확인할 수 있습니다 : GWT SDK, 웹 응용 프로그램 libs와, EAR libs와, JRE, 메이븐을 . 모두 아래쪽으로 이동하면 오류가 사라집니다. – membersound

+0

@ mememound 위대한 듣고 :) – Arpit

2

Maven GAE Plugin 이 플러그인은 GAE 응용 프로그램을 실행, 디버그, 배포하는 등의 목표를 가지고 있습니다.

1

내 컴퓨터에서 우분투 12.04 및 Eclipse Juno SR1 난 단지 모든 빌드 종속성을 자바 빌드 경로 목록의 버튼으로 이동합니다. 열린 자바 빌드 경로 창에 대한

프로젝트를 마우스 오른쪽 클릭 - 환경 설정 - 자바 빌드 경로 - 주문 및 수출 을 - "바닥"M2_REPO 모든 행 (또는 다른 어떤 것을)와 버튼을 누르면 를 선택 - 새로 고침 계획. 도움이 필요합니다.

감사합니다.

관련 문제